Currently I'm 34yrs old and my 4rm HDB in Sembawang just MOP. It's under my name as sole owner and my wife was added as an occupant when we purchase the flat. Now she gotten her PR for 4yrs and would it make her as a first timer if she get her condo on her own? Or I transfer the flat to her and loan from my side as my income is much higher than her?

Yes it will be considered as 1st property purchase for the condo, but ABSD of 5% applies still as she is PR. You can't transfer ownership to her as hdb only allows transfer of ownership in exceptional cases such as financial hardship. You may want to consider purchasing under your name instead as you can get a higher loan, although your ABSD will be considered 7%.

If your spouse were to purchase private property, ABSD payable will be 5% as it would be considered as her first property. Mortgage will be calculated based on her income and she can utilize her CPF for the necessary payments, less ABSD. If you were to purchase your second unit, ABSD payable will be 7%. Mortgage loan will be max of 50% if your current unit is still on mortgage. You will have to set aside the required CPF Basic Retirement sum before you can utilize the balance for the payment on your second property.

As per your plans , your wife will have to pay ABSD since she is a p r if she buy a property as sole owner .

You are not able to transfer your hdb to her .

Alternatively you may want to consider selling off your hdb and buy a condo together with your wife , the advantages are NOT having to pay ABSD and may borrow more with two income and 2 owner.
